Question #301162

Two coins are tossed. Let H be the number of tails that occur.Determine the values of the random variable H.

Let's denote H - heads, T - tails.

Sample space S is all possible outcomes.


"S = \\{HH, TH, HT, TT\\}"

Let "h" be the random variables representing the number of tails that occur. The possible values of "h" are "0,1,2."



"\\def\\arraystretch{1.5}\n \\begin{array}{c:c}\n Sample\\ point & y \\\\ \\hline\n HH & 0 \\\\\n \\hdashline\n TH & 1 \\\\\n \\hdashline\n HT & 1 \\\\\n \\hdashline\n TT & 2 \\\\\n \\hdashline\n\\end{array}"


"\\def\\arraystretch{1.5}\n \\begin{array}{c:c}\n h & 0 & 1 & 2 \\\\ \\hline\n p(h) & 1\/4 & 1\/2 & 1\/4\n\\end{array}"
